Released in 1953 to celebrate Ford's 50th anniversary, the Golden Jubilee tractor proudly features the special Golden Jubilee emblem on the front. It marked the transition from the earlier 8N model and formed the new NAA series.
Slightly larger than the 8N, the Golden Jubilee includes several upgrades, such as live hydraulics, selectable position and draft control, and a 4-cylinder overhead valve petrol engine—replacing the side-valve engine used in the 8N.
